1/ April 20, 1938: the USSR made russian mandatory in all schools in Soviet Ukraine.
This wasn’t “education.” It was policy - russification by design.
Language was weaponized to erase identity and manufacture the obedient “Soviet person.”

On March 21, 2022 Ukraine launched an air operation to evacuate the wounded and deliver provisions to the defenders of the besieged Azovstal.
Pilots knew this might be their final flight, but helped the city garrison to hold the line.
